Ashbir Aviat Fadila is a scholar working on Electrical and Electronic Engineering, Aerospace Engineering and Biomedical Engineering. According to data from OpenAlex, Ashbir Aviat Fadila has authored 20 papers receiving a total of 108 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Electrical and Electronic Engineering, 7 papers in Aerospace Engineering and 2 papers in Biomedical Engineering. Recurrent topics in Ashbir Aviat Fadila’s work include Radio Frequency Integrated Circuit Design (15 papers), Microwave Engineering and Waveguides (6 papers) and Full-Duplex Wireless Communications (5 papers). Ashbir Aviat Fadila is often cited by papers focused on Radio Frequency Integrated Circuit Design (15 papers), Microwave Engineering and Waveguides (6 papers) and Full-Duplex Wireless Communications (5 papers). Ashbir Aviat Fadila collaborates with scholars based in Japan, United States and South Korea. Ashbir Aviat Fadila's co-authors include Atsushi Shirane, Jian Pang, Kenichi Okada, Ibrahim Abdo, Hideyuki Nosaka, Hiroshi Hamada, Dongwon You, Bangan Liu, Yun Wang and Chun Wang and has published in prestigious journals such as IEEE Journal of Solid-State Circuits, IEEE Solid-State Circuits Magazine and IEEE Solid-State Circuits Letters.
